In 2022, 17.2% of the population lived in extreme poverty, defined as living on less than us$2.15 (2017 ppp) per day
[citation needed] the gambia is a founding member of the ecowas. The country is less than 48 kilometres (30 mi) wide at its greatest width. The gambia, officially the republic of the gambia, is a country in west africa Geographically, the gambia is the smallest country in continental africa It is surrounded by senegal on all sides except for the western part, which is bordered by the atlantic ocean.
The gambia gained independence in 1965 as a constitutional monarchy that remained part of the commonwealth as sir firamang singhateh as the first gambian governor from 1065 to 1970 many agree that gambia did not attain full independence as the country was still under the british control, but in 1970 became a presidential republic. The gambia is divided into five administrative regions (until 2007 these were known as divisions) and one city The divisions of the gambia are created by the independent electoral commission in accordance to article 192 of the national constitution [1] during the 2013 census, the western region was the most populated with a population of 699,704, while the lower river region was the least.
